CSS3 详解

嗨,大家好!今天我要给大家分享一下CSS3的重要知识点,这是一个非常流行的网页设计技术。可能有些人对CSS3还不太了解,没关系,我会从基础开始给大家讲解。

首先,CSS是层叠样式表(Cascading Style Sheets)的简称,它用于美化和布局网页元素。CSS使用选择器来指定要应用样式的HTML元素,然后通过属性值来定义样式。CSS3是CSS的最新版本,引入了许多新的功能和特性。

说到特性,我首先要介绍的就是新的选择器。CSS3中增加了许多新的选择器,让我们能够更灵活地选择元素。比如,我们可以用属性选择器根据元素的属性值来选择元素,或者用伪类选择器选择元素的特殊状态,比如鼠标悬停或点击。这些新的选择器为我们提供了更多的自由度和创造力。

除了选择器,CSS3还引入了许多新的样式属性和值,让我们能够创建更丰富多样的效果。比如,我们可以用border-radius属性来创建圆角边框,用box-shadow属性来添加元素的投影效果,或者用text-shadow属性来给文字添加阴影效果。这些属性让我们的设计更加生动有趣。

不仅如此,CSS3还支持渐变、动画、过渡等效果。我们可以用linear-gradient函数创建线性渐变背景,用radial-gradient函数创建径向渐变背景,以及用animation和transition属性来实现动画和过渡效果。这些效果让我们的网页更富有动感和互动性。

另外,CSS3还引入了响应式设计的概念,让我们的网页能够适应不同的设备和屏幕大小。通过使用媒体查询和弹性布局,我们可以根据屏幕的宽度和高度来调整元素的排列和大小,使网页在不同的设备上都能够呈现出最佳的效果。这样,无论是在电脑、平板还是手机上,我们的网页都能够完美展示。

最后,我要提到的是CSS3的兼容性。虽然CSS3提供了许多新的功能和特性,但是并不是所有的浏览器都完全支持。尤其是一些旧版本的浏览器,对CSS3的支持程度较低。因此,在使用CSS3的时候,我们需要考虑到不同浏览器的兼容性,可以使用浏览器前缀来兼容不同浏览器,或者使用JavaScript库来处理兼容性问题。

总的来说,CSS3是一项非常重要的网页设计技术,它为我们提供了更多的选择和创造力。通过使用CSS3的新特性,我们可以创建出更丰富多样的效果,使我们的网页更加生动有趣。尽管CSS3的兼容性存在一定的问题,但是通过合理的处理和妥善的兼容性解决方案,我们仍然可以在不同的浏览器上呈现出相似的效果。

希望今天的文章能够给大家带来一些新的知识和灵感,让大家在网页设计中能够更加出色。如果还有什么问题,欢迎在评论区提问,我会尽力回答。谢谢大家的阅读!加油! www.0574web.net 宁波海美seo网络优化公司 是网页设计制作,网站优化,企业关键词排名,网络营销知识和开发爱好者的一站式目的地,提供丰富的信息、资源和工具来帮助用户创建令人惊叹的实用网站。 该平台致力于提供实用、相关和最新的内容,这使其成为初学者和经验丰富的专业人士的宝贵资源。

点赞(33) 打赏

声明本文内容来自网络,若涉及侵权,请联系我们删除! 投稿需知:请以word形式发送至邮箱18067275213@163.com

评论列表 共有 1 条评论

Electric bikes 5月前 回复TA

我昨天也刚好查看了一下google analytics的数据,对比这篇文章,看得格外清晰Google的analytics工具 – 我所知最完善的网站访问统计工具.2maomao.com/blog/google-analytics/

微信小程序

微信扫一扫体验

立即
投稿

微信公众账号

微信扫一扫加关注

发表
评论
返回
顶部